The entrance sign for Blists Hill Victorian Town, part of the Ironbridge Gorge UNESCO World Heritage Site, now under National Trust stewardship. The sign features the National Trust oak leaf logo at top left alongside the text "Ironbridge Gorge" on a dark red background. Below, a large teal panel reads "Welcome to Blists Hill Victorian Town" in bold white lettering. A lower white panel headed "Re-opening Ironbridge sites under National Trust care" lists reopening schedules for several sites including Blists Hill, Coalbrookdale, Jackfield Tiles, Coalport, Toll House, Broseley Pipes, and others, with dates ranging from May to September 2026. Small illustrated icons represent each attraction. The National Trust logo appears again at the foot of the sign.

Blists Hill Victorian Town, proudly reopened under National Trust care.
